2. Liquidity

Liquidity is the ease with which a cryptocurrency can be bought or sold without significantly affecting its price. High liquidity means that a cryptocurrency can be bought or sold quickly and at a fair price. This factor is particularly important for short-term traders and those who may need to liquidate their investments quickly.

When evaluating liquidity, consider the trading volume of the cryptocurrency on major exchanges. High trading volume suggests that the asset is highly liquid, making it an attractive option for investors looking for quick entry and exit points.

4. Community Support

The success of a cryptocurrency often hinges on its community. A strong, active community can drive innovation, improve the technology, and increase adoption. Look for cryptocurrencies with active development teams, a loyal user base, and a vibrant online community.
